We are seeking a coordinator to support the Work of The Central Hub, which is made up of members from Ontario and Quebec. The Central Hub Coordinator works to actualize the broader goals and vision of Righting Relations.

The Central Hub Coordinator is responsible for facilitating collaboration among Ontario and Quebec; outreach to new partners and funders; and maintaining a provincial contact list and relationships. They also ensure the region is in alignment with the overall long term plan. They build relationships with potential funders and partners, and provide oversight of the overall budget and planning/reporting processes under the guidance and direction of the Central Hub Advisory Council.

Responsibilities:

  • Ensuring each Circle (currently Hamilton, Quebec and Toronto) has everything they need to do their work and are accountable to the mandate of Righting Relations;
  • Convening and facilitating meetings of the Central Hub Advisory Council in the spirit of shared leadership;
  • Supporting the reporting and ongoing monitoring and evaluation processes for our main funder, the Catherine Donnelly Foundation, and other funding bodies as required;
  • Working alongside the Central Hub Advisory Council to develop fundraising goals and seek out, develop and submit grant proposals as capacity allows;
  • Outreach and relationship building in the Central Hub to build our network, reach, and impact;
  • Accounting for expenses and following provincial and national finance guidelines through collaboration with the bookkeeper;
  • Facilitating and documenting processes for Central Hub members to collaborate on visioning, goal setting, learning, reflection, and ongoing monitoring and evaluation;
  • Onboarding of new members with a regular orientation process;
  • Coordinate local and regional gatherings, learning exchanges, and other opportunities for learning regionally and provincially in collaboration with other RR coordinators and National Coordinator.

Term of Contract

This is a 3-month probationary position ideally starting in December or January. The Coordinator will work between 5-8 hrs a week and be on a flexible schedule. The coordinator will work from home, and have their own computer. The rate of pay will start at $30 per hour.

This contract has the potential for annual renewal pending performance.
